- The distance between Pirenopolis, Brazil and Dawei, Myanmar is approximately 16,488 km or 10,246 mi.
- To reach Pirenopolis in this distance one would set out from Dawei bearing 262.6°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Pirenopolis bearing 268.7° or W .
- Pirenopolis has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Dawei has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Pirenopolis is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Dawei is in or near the tropical wet for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.1 °C (7.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.1 °C (0.2°F) less in Pirenopolis.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 3733.8 mm (147 in) less which is equivalent to 3733.8 l/m² (91.64 US gal/ft²) or 37,338,000 l/ha (3,991,680 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.7° lower in Pirenopolis than in Dawei.
